    EDP SA maintains a capital structure with a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.05, indicating a relatively high leverage position compared to the industry median. The company's liquidity is assessed as medium, with a current ratio of 1.15 and negative net cash after subtracting total debt. Free cash flow is negative at -1.71 billion EUR, primarily due to capital expenditures of -4.28 billion EUR, which suggests ongoing investment in infrastructure.

    Profitability metrics show a return on equity (ROE) of 10.14% and a return on assets (ROA) of 2.09%. These figures are below the industry median for ROE and ROA, indicating that EDP SA is underperforming in terms of asset and equity utilization compared to its peers.

    Geographically, EDP SA's revenue is concentrated in Portugal and other European markets, with no disclosed breakdown of segment performance. The company's exposure to European energy markets makes it sensitive to regulatory and geopolitical shifts, particularly in the context of the European Union's energy transition policies.

    The company's growth trajectory is mixed. Revenue for the latest period was 13.85 billion EUR, and while the company is investing heavily in capital expenditures, the free cash flow remains negative. Analysts have a cautiously optimistic outlook, with a mean price target of 4.79 EUR and a median of 4.60 EUR, suggesting moderate upside potential.

    Risk factors include medium liquidity risk and a negative net cash position after subtracting total debt. The dilution potential is assessed as low, with no significant dilution sources identified in the latest filings. However, the company's high leverage and negative free cash flow could pose challenges in maintaining financial flexibility.

    Recent events include the publication of the latest financial results, which show a net income of 1.15 billion EUR and operating income of 2.84 billion EUR. The company has not disclosed any major new projects or strategic shifts in the latest filings, but the ongoing investment in capital expenditures suggests a focus on long-term infrastructure development.

    How metrics are computed
    • Dilution Ratio
      (shares_outstanding_diluted - shares_outstanding_basic) / shares_outstanding_basic
    • Net Cash
      cash_and_equivalents + short_term_investments - short_term_debt - long_term_debt
    • Capex To Revenue
      capital_expenditure / revenue
    • Return On Equity
      net_income / total_equity
    • Debt To Equity
      (short_term_debt + long_term_debt) / total_equity
    • Cash Conversion Ratio
      operating_cash_flow / net_income
